  • Statistics for Bristol, Tennessee

  • The population of Bristol is 38,992. 18,863 are Males and 20,129 are Females.

    The Total Area covered by Bristol, Tennessee is 142.07 Sq. Miles.
    The population density in Bristol, TN. is 293.49 persons/sq. mile.
    The Bristol elevation is 1596 Ft.

    Enrollment and Education for Bristol:
    8,418 students are enrolled in school in Bristol, Tennessee (over 3 years of age).
    Of those who are enrolled in Bristol:
    530 students are attending Nursery School in Bristol.
    594 students are enrolled in Kindergarten.
    3,730 students in Bristol are enrolled in Primary School
    1,923 students attend High School in Bristol.
    1,641 students attend College in Bristol.
    Bristol Employment Info:
    17,984 people are employed in Bristol.
    819 people are unemployed in Bristol, Tennessee.
    Data on Household Economics in Bristol:
    Household earnings breakdown:
    Under $10,000 yearly: 2,261
    $10,000.00 to $14,999 yearly: 1,397
    $15,000 to $24,999 yearly: 2,877
    $25,000 to $34,999 yearly: 2,570
    $35,000 to $49,999 yearly: 2,991
    $50,000 to $74,999 yearly: 2,600
    $75,000 to $99,999 yearly: 890
    $100,000 to $149,999 yearly: 464
    $150,000 to $199,999 yearly: 122
    $200,000 or more yearly: 237

The main difference between short-term and long-term is either a short 30-day drug and alcohol rehab program in Bristol or long-term that is typically 3-6 months. The short-term 30-day drug rehab in Bristol options are centers which primarily focus on getting the person through detox and withdrawal so they are physically stabilized, after which do as much as they are able to during the rest of their stay to help them have the ability to stay sober. This may include counseling and therapeutic methods and helping them make lifestyle changes to enable them to remove unfavorable influences from their life which could make them relapse. 30 days is certainly a short amount of time to be able to achieve all this and anyone looking for rehab in a short-term rehab must be aware it isn't always a successful effort due to how brief the rehab period is. When someone has experienced a life threatening drug or alcohol problem, the best thing to do is to reevaluate one's situation prior to leaving a short-term drug rehab in Bristol, and if you have more to get done it is always a good idea to transition into a long-term program if at all possible.

At a long-term drug rehab in Bristol, success rates are much higher because usually it takes the thirty days one would spend within a short term drug rehab in Bristol just to overcome all the acute physical problems one encounters when just getting off of drugs and alcohol. Someone who is just getting off of heroin by way of example will experience extreme withdrawal symptoms for around a week then less serious symptoms including intense cravings to use for many more weeks. It's challenging to concentrate on the real rehab process which handles the causes of one's habit with all of this occurring, so being able to be treated and also have any chance at long-term sobriety is a lot more realistic in a long-term Bristol drug rehab. So following detox and after overcoming the withdrawal symptoms, men and women within a long-term drug rehab in Bristol can take part in treatment services which can tackle the actual reasons that someone began abusing drugs initially. This usually has a lot more to do with deep underlying problems that have nothing to do with the acute physical challenges addressed in short-term Bristol rehabilitation facility.

Additionally, there are programs in Bristol which don't actually deliver any rehab at all but make use of healthcare drugs to help clients get off of drugs. Methadone centers for instance have been in existence for a long time, first utilized with the intention to help heroin addicts stop drug seeking habits and prevent effects of heroin use such as criminal behavior and its consequences in addition to health effects. These kinds of facilities which now include buprenorphine as well as some other medicines are called opioid maintenance therapy, and this therapy now covers problems related to prescription medication abuse because these medicines are now abused at comparable rates to heroin nowadays. The reason why a lot of people may turn to this kind of program as a solution is because they feel they can't deal with the urges and withdrawal symptoms which they will ultimately have to deal with whenever they stop using cold turkey. So as an alternative, the seemingly easy way out is by using methadone or even a comparable medicine which stops cravings and withdrawal symptoms, but is a regiment which itself must be taken care of to prevent craving and withdrawal. Which means this too isn't a very ideal circumstance for somebody who wished to fully eliminate substances from their life that they rely on for either physical or mental satisfaction.
